Start Your ELDT Class B Training Online

If you are preparing to earn a Class B Commercial Driver’s License (CDL), you are required by federal regulations to complete Entry-Level Driver Training (ELDT) before taking the CDL skills test. The Smart Horizons ELDT Class B Theory course helps drivers complete the required training and move one step closer to earning their CDL.

Next Week is National Work Zone Awareness Week!

National Work Zone Awareness Week is a spring campaign held at the start of construction season to encourage safe driving through highway work zones and raise awareness of risks to motorists and roadway workers. The key message is for drivers to use extra caution in work zones. NWZAW 2026 is hosted by the Connecticut Department of Transportation (CTDOT).
